I had been having intermittent problems with the MAF, I would jiggle the wire and find a good spot to leave it at and all was fine for a few hundred miles. Anyway I ordered a new MAF connector and wire ends from Joe. I have the parts and was ready to install when I found out that I don't have enough wire left. When I install the small metal clips to the three wires it will be to tight or even not enough slack. I know I need to splice wire to wire, but will this be ok?? Any help will be appreciated!! I have a 94 Q. Wayne

Should be just fine. Solder the connections and use heat-shrink to protect and keep clean. I probably should do the same. What did those cost? Any part numbers? Thanks.

The connector was around $25, and each small metal clip that fit on the end of each wire was around $1.50. I think you have to crimp the metal ends. Forgive the dumb question but what is heat-shrinkK. Thanks

Plastic tubing that fits over the connection, then you heat it with a lighter or heat gun and it shrinks tight to seal the connection from the elements.
